Bridging GNSS Outages with IMU and Odometry: A Case Study for Agricultural Vehicles
Nowadays, many precision farming applications rely on the use of GNSS-RTK. However, when it comes to autonomous agricultural vehicles, GNSS cannot be used as a stand-alone system for positioning.
